A man who terrified his mother and a friend by banging on her door with a metal pole has been placed on probation.
Joshua Thomas Gilardoni of no fixed abode appeared before High Bailiff Jayne Hughes at Douglas Courthouse.
The 20 year old admitted using provoking behaviour in Tynwald Road in Willaston on July 30.
Prosecutor Barry Swain said unemployed Gilardoni had turned up at the woman's home at 11pm, demanding to be let in.
When she refused, he spent hours banging her door and shouting until police arrived and arrested him.
Mrs Hughes ordered him to spend 12 months under the supervision of the probation service.
